Reviewed by oazam 6 / 10

Decent action but with a generic story and horrible music.

Abhinay Deo is decent as a director. I was impressed with his direction in Delhi Belly. But this movie just didn't match my expectations for him. The prequel wasn't bad but the direction and action were pretty sloppy done by Nishikant Kamat and Ayananka Bose. This movie was a bit better than the prequel but with nothing to tell.

John Abraham has good abs but can't act. His rough humor and acting turns out to be a snooze fest but his acting was bearable during the action scenes and that's basically it.

Sonakshi Sinha was okay in some parts. At least she is doing some sensible roles just like Akira because I am tired of seeing her waiting for Chulbul Pandey cutting vegetables.

Tahir Raj Bhasin was great as a villain. I believe he brought some good mentality from Mardaani in which he also performed well.

The story and screenplay was the biggest downfall in this movie. It is almost like Jason Bourne-Mad Max combo but with no script. The direction was okay in some parts usually when it came to action sequences but the editing was a bit too problematic in such when they were doing aerial shots but the editing of the action sequences were good and crisp. The music was a disappointment except Rang Laal where JA kills it with his voice and rap. Abhinay Deo managed to give good action just like the car chasing, building chasing, shooting, and etc. The cinematography was also pretty good especially when they roped in Imre Juhasz who was a DOP for Die Hard.

This movie also presented RAW in a very bad way in such of missions and etc. Narendra Jha was quite bad as a Raw senior and he was over the top.

I felt Genelia wasn't needed but since it was sequel, I was okay with it but her role kinda stretched the movie to a small extent which took up a bit of the time especially when there was a song dedicated to it.

Overall this movie was okay in terms of Action and Tahir's acting but the partial mediocre direction and screenplay bought the film down which is why Force 2 is definitely worth watching but on a TV Broadcast or a Netflix.

2/5- action improved but story needs to be improved

Reviewed by lediscipledessocrates 2 / 10

Why So Stupid?

"RAW is an agency that operates on secrecy".

For a movie based on the life of an intelligence agency operative, these are hardly intelligent lines.

Named, Force 2, the movie features John Abraham as the tough and tenacious cop from Mumbai who is out to seek revenge for a buddy ( an Indian spy) , killed in the line of duty.

Jingoistic in demeanor , the story crawls on a tight rope from the beginning before falling and drowning in the sea of stupidity.

John ji provides glimpses of his robotic genes, Sonakshi does well to portray an incompetent intelligence officer. Tahir Bhasin tries to play the slick and deviously clever bad guy but ends up looking like an irritating moth that is harmless per se but for its annoying presence.

The movie borrows set designs from countless American spy flicks. The chase sequences are a tribute to Bourne and company . However, speaking existentially, the movie's main plot is inspired from Soldier (1998) ( if you search it on IMDb you will have to use the general search button since the auto recommendations are other movies), which is basically about a guy avenging his father's death , who was killed and branded a traitor by the bad guys.

Melodramatic, cheesy with bad jokes and ordinary editing, the movie is boring. To add insult to injury there are quite a few sequences that attempt to recreate The Da Vinci Code(2006) moments. To be fair, The Da Vinci code itself was pretentious and this fits well in the scheme of things here.

I have nothing more to add. You can avoid the movie.

Reviewed by ketgup83 7 / 10

"Force 2" is a treat for action film lovers. Despite few shortcomings, the stunts and nice action scenes will keep you engrossed

Action films based on Indian RAW agents have been fairly successful in Bollywood. Salman Khan and Katrina Kaif starrer "Ek Tha Tiger" was a blockbuster while Saif Ali Khan's "Phantom" was turned down by the audience even though both the films were made by Kabir Khan. The sequel to 2011's hit, "Force", "Force 2" is yet another attempt to salute the RAW agent, the unsung heroes of our country. Will it do justice to that ? Let us find out ...

Yashwardhan (played by John Abraham) partners with RAW agent KK (played by Sonakshi Sinha) to track down the mastermind criminal, Shiv (played by Tahir Raj Bhasin), who is on the verge of swiping out every RAW agent India has produced. The cat-and-mouse game begins which leads to the mystery behind the killing of the Indian RAW agent.

Directed by Abhinay Deo, who previous laugh-a-thon "Delhi Belly" and suspense thriller "Game", "Force 2" is a complete out-an-out action film which is a treat for action film lovers. The movie does start with a bang with the introduction of each primary characters and takes it forward. Initial few reels does have nail-biting moments like car lifting scene, the chase scene between John Abraham and Tahir Raj Bhasin in Budapest and the twist before the interval. However, the second half loses the steam and few of the action scenes looks repetitive. The good part is that screenplay will keep you engaged though it has share of flaws.

Few scenes will arise while watching "Force 2" - Why on earth a criminal be escorted to India from a foreign land only by 2 officers ? How come so many people start popping out every time Shiv is being taken away by India police? Despite, these shortcoming, I felt the thrills and punches are good enough to keep you at bay. Cinematography is good. I like the first-person camera fight in the climax. Art direction is just about okay. Dialogues are fine. Editing is bad and so is the music.

Performance wise, it is Tahir Raj Bhasin who walks away being a hero of the film. The actor is definitely talented but should do more variety of roles rather than doing the same stuff similar to "Mardani". John Abraham does a fine job as rugged and tough officer. Sonakshi Sinha could not do justice to her part this.

Overall, "Force 2" is a treat for action film lovers. Despite few shortcomings, the stunts and nice action scenes will keep you engrossed. Good 3/5
